Deutsche Börse: Cash Market Trading Volumes In June
Deutsche Börse’s cash markets generated a turnover of €198.8 billion in June (previous year: €116.0 billion).
€166.0 billion were attributable to Xetra (previous year: €106.3 billion), bringing the average daily Xetra trading volume to €7.9 billion. Trading volume on Börse Frankfurt was €5.2 billion (previous year: €2.3 billion) and on Tradegate Exchange €27.6 billion (previous year: €7.5 billion).
By type of asset class, equities accounted for around €175.0 billion in the entire cash market. Trading in ETFs/ETCs/ETNs generated a turnover of €21.2 billion. Turnover in bonds was €0.4 billion, in certificates €1.9 billion and in funds €0.2 billion.
The DAX stock with the highest turnover on Xetra in June was SAP SE with €9.2 billion. Commerzbank AG led the MDAX with €1.4 billion, while Shop Apotheke Europe led the SDAX index with €245 million. In the ETF segment, the iShares Core DAX UCITS ETF generated the largest volume with €1.1 billion.
